As we saw in the last article, there are two types of form development approaches that we can use in Angular. The first one is template-driven development and the other is the reactive forms approach. Let’s explore what reactive forms are and how to validate reactive forms in Angular.
What Are Reactive Forms?
This approach uses the reactive form of developing the forms that favor the explicit management of data between the UI and the model. With this approach, we create a tree of Angular form controls and bind them in the native form controls. As we can create the forms control directly in the component, it makes it a bit easier to push the data between the data models and the UI elements.